
The country experiences over 3000 hours of sunshine, one of the highest in Europe. In addition to the weather, there are a number of things to do, including discovering its rich culture and history and, of course, participating in various activities such as snorkelling, kayaking, parasailing, horse riding, and rock climbing.

The perfect sunshine continues right into the summertime when the average temperature reaches 32C, which is perfect for sun-seeking travellers across the globe. Another feature that makes Malta a location a great holiday is that the country sees a fraction of the tourists that many popular destinations in Europe see.

Spain, which is also among the warmest countries in Europe and loved by UK holidaymakers, welcomed 94 million tourists yesterday, whereas Malta saw just 3.56 million, which was a record for the island.
So, as well as sunshine, warm weather, and an abundance of fun activities, travellers can add not having to experience crowds of tourists to the list.
Brits can get a direct flight to the country’s capital from London Gatwick, Heathrow, Luton, Stansted Airports, with skyscanner showing one-way flights from £46 in April.
